In this conversation with Anna Dearmon Kornick, a time management coach and founder of the It's About Time Academy, listeners discover why high achievers grapple with overwhelm. Anna explains the pitfalls of multitasking and how context switching drains energy. She shares powerful strategies like theme days to maintain focus and emphasizes small, sustainable shifts over drastic changes. Lastly, Anna challenges the notion of work-life balance as a myth, encouraging personal definitions that foster true fulfillment.

INSIGHT

Information Overload Amplifies Achievement-Driven Stress

  • We process more incoming information daily than ever, which fuels a constant sense of overwhelm.
  • High achievers crave closure, so endless inputs plus unfinished tasks intensify restlessness.
INSIGHT

Unfinished Tasks Hijack Your Mind

  • The Zeigarnik effect makes our brains fixate on unfinished tasks, increasing mental noise at night.
  • Combining endless inputs with a drive to finish creates chronic restlessness for high achievers.
INSIGHT

Variety, Not Hours, Drives Overwhelm

  • Overwhelm often stems from variety, not total hours worked; more projects mean more context switches.
  • Every switch leaks focus, reducing productivity and increasing mistakes.
